Overview of the Update
The new WhatsApp icon is an effort in a series of efforts that aim at beautifying the already popular application. The update may be small, but it’s a conscious design decision – and its goal is to create a clear, concise and visually appealing look. The change in the icon design is adjustment in the gradient color wherein the previous flat design is replaced with a new gradient color. This adjustment provides a new look making it closer to other modern Android apps as we see it. This blur change improves the overall look of the app while maintaining the green color people will easily identify the app with.
